Страница 1 из 1

PCA9685

Добавлено: 18 фев 2016, 10:47
SHREK-2
Здравствуйте!
Проектирурю одну мечту детства; :D решения приемлемого по затратам в аналоговом варианте не нашёл.
Придётся изучать процессоры и контроллеры....
Вкратце задача, что стоит передо мной такова: Есть 16 каналов имеющих на выходе аналоговый сигнал в виде постоянного напряжения. По команде устройство должно измерить в каждом канале потенциал, запомнить, и зеркально соотнести со скважностью на выходе PCA9685 .
Т.Е. При большем потенциале скважность 1/80 при меньшем 80/1. Цифры даны условно.
На выходах PCA9685 будет стоять ОЭП - 10.
Вообще то это автоматический 16 полосный эквалайзер и регулировки это регулировки в усиления в полосе. Отсюда и ОЭП на выходе.
Подскажите,КАК правильно состыковать PCA9685 с управляющим устройством, какое устройство (контроллер) порекомендуете, буду благодарен за конструктивную инфу.

Re: PCA9685

Добавлено: 18 фев 2016, 11:20
rhf-admin
:shock: У атмелов 16-канальные ADC есть только в 100-ногих монстрах, типа ATMega2560.
Мне кажется проще взять отдельные ADC I2C-шные и повесить их на общую шину с PCA9685. Так пожалуй и быстрее будет.
Вон, есть, например, у Linear-ов чипы LTC2309, - 8-канальный I2C ADC. Парочка таких чипов и можно будет управляющий контроллер не такой жирный взять.

Re: PCA9685

Добавлено: 18 фев 2016, 13:51
SHREK-2
Спасибо!
Я хоть и с паяльником более 20 лет, но к сожалению, совершенный ноль в процессорах. Жёсткую логику я еще знаю :shock:
Не могли бы вы назвать "не очень жирный процессор" из распостранённых?

Re: PCA9685

Добавлено: 18 фев 2016, 15:43
rhf-admin
Из нежирных, например ATtiny2313 или ATMega 8.
Но! Я тут вот что вспомнил. Сейчас же есть дешёвые армы, они и быстрее в n-цать раз и производительнее. Можно взять, например, STM32F103C8T6, у него как раз до 16-ти каналов АЦП можно включить, частота до 72 МГц (у атмелок не выше 20), по цене наверное даже дешевле выйдет, с учётом того, что отпадает необходимость во внешних АЦП. Только корпусов у них удобных нет, но запаять можно, ног не так много.
STM32F030R8T6 - 18 каналов.

Re: PCA9685

Добавлено: 18 фев 2016, 16:23
SHREK-2
Прекрасно!
У меня где то валяется плата с STM 32. Купил с год назад, но не разбирался - костлявая нога голода переодически наступает на горло и ..... свободного времени пр. нет.